

Estimates are usually prepared within a few days, depending on project complexity and required site evaluations. Larger commercial projects may need additional review time.
Yes, changes may occur if materials, design, or scope are adjusted during construction. Contractors will communicate updates clearly to maintain transparency.
Most reputable contractors offer detailed breakdowns showing labor, materials, and related costs. This helps clients understand exactly where investments are allocated.
Many contractors offer free initial estimates, though large-scale or detailed project plans may require a consultation fee. Policies vary by company.
Discuss priorities, material preferences, and must-have features early. Contractors can recommend modifications that maintain quality while keeping costs manageable.
